Band Mill Advantages
A big
advantage in using a mobile Woodmizer sawmill
service is eliminating the haul cost. The conventional sawmill is
stationary to which you must deliver the logs and must retrieve the
lumber. The mobile Woodmizer sawmill eliminates both of these
challenges.
Another
big advantage is that the mobile Woodmizer mill is a band saw. The
blade kerf is
1/16 th of an inch. This means much less sawdust, therefore, more
lumber per log (30%-40% more than a conventional sawmill.)
The
Woodmizer band saw style sawmill makes a very clean cut leaving very
small (if
any) saw marks on the lumber

Board
Foot
|
A volume
measurement of wood. 1 board foot (bf) = 1foot wide x 1foot long x 1inch thick |
|
Cant
|
The block of wood remaining from a log after removing the bark. |
|
Kerf |
The thickness of wood that is removed with one pass of the blade. |
